Olenye

Olenye (Russian: Оленье) is a rural locality (a selo) and the administrative center of Olenyevskoye Rural Settlement, Dubovsky District, Volgograd Oblast, Russia. The population was 1,012 as of 2010.[2] There are 38 streets.

Geography

The village is located on the right bank of the Volga, 15 km north from Dubovka.
